**Vendor note: Inkmill markdown pipeline**

Rendering for Parchway docs is outsourced to Inkmill under an annual contract, renewing each March. They handle sanitization and PDF export; we own the upload queue. SLA: 4-hour response on rendering failures. Escalate only after two failed retries. Their support desk is reachable at the address below.

billing contact of hahaf-baguf = zorael.tammir.jorius@sivrelhq.internal

## Deployment

The Pondermill billing worker uses blue-green deploys. Two identical stacks (blue and green) run behind the job router; only one consumes the billing queue at a time. To release, deploy to the idle stack, run the smoke suite against it, then flip the router. Keep the old stack warm for one hour in case of rollback. Both stacks must share the configuration shown below.

deployment values, bahof-badug:
[rusix]
team = zorok
access_code = ac_641cbe
owner = ulair.tamius
host = rusix.torvasoft.local
port = 5672
peer = ulaix.sivrelworks.internal
salt = 1df570ed
pin = 6327

TURN-208: Gatevale turnstile counters at the Merrow Field pilot double-count when a rotation reverses mid-cycle. Attendance totals drift roughly 2% high per event. The debounce window fix is implemented, reviewed by Ilsa, and soak-tested across two simulated match days without drift. Ready for your cut; the candidate build is identified below.

trace token, tagag-tafog: htk6_5ed18c